Adam
3:52
Should the tigers prioritize getting rid of salary or acquiring prospects? Especially Upton walks they have very little long term MLB talent in starting positions
Steve Adams
3:53
I don't think they're all that interested in shedding salary just to shed it. Their focus, rightfully, is on improving the farm *and* paring back payroll, in conjunction, in order to build a more sustainable long-term contender. They're not going to let Verlander or Kinsler go just to clear dollars. Someone like Anibal or Zimmermann, sure they would, but no one's going to go near those two right now (especially not JZ)

Could 7/238 bring Arenado to the South Side of Chicago?
Steve Adams
4:01
I honestly don't even think that's enough to extend him right now. He's going to make $17.75MM next season and probably $23-24MM or so in his final arb year, then hit free agency as a 28-year-old. At that point, he's seeking 10+ years and $300MM+

As Justin Upton continues to mash, does it seem more likely he opts out? Will he get a similar contract to what he has now or would he he another year or more money?
Steve Adams
4:07
I think it's more plausible than a lot of reporters seem to. He's been one of the 5-10 best hitters on the planet for the past calendar year and has absolutely raked dating back to July 1, 2016. He basically had three terrible months to open his Tigers career and has been great since.
4:08
Yoenis Cespedes got 4/110 last winter, and he was a year older than Upton will be this winter. Hanley Ramirez got 4/88 when he was older and moving to LF with zero experience.
4:09
Upton has 4/88.5 left on his deal and a 145ish wRC+ over the past 365 days. And he's an average or better left fielder that can't receive a QO. I think he has a very real chance of beating $88MM on the open market, and he may also have the opportunity to move to a more clear contender.
